There is no mention of a font in Glynne's (1877) entry for this church. The Parish website [http://www.cuxtonandhalling.org.uk/cuxton.htm] [accessed 18 February 2010] informs: "Next to the door is the font […] The existing font is Victorian. Bits of its Mediaeval predecessor were half buried in the churchyard but are now inside for better preservation […] On the left of the door are the remains of a stoup."
